India imports Russian coal through INSTC

INSTC is taking the shape of an energy corridor as India plans to import coal from Russia through this route. India has long been planning to use the corridor to trade with Russia and Iran as well.

Russian coal will be reaching Indian ports via Bandar Abbas Port of Iran in the Indian Ocean. Thus India’s investment in Chabahar Port is justified as it forms a crucial node in connectivity for trade with Russia, Central Asia and Europe while bypassing Pakistan.

As part of this crucial infrastructure, Iran is also building a 700-kilometre railway line that connects Chabahar port to the country’s railway network at the city of Zahedan. Such a connection could boost the attractiveness of freight transportation through the port and along the INSTC, for which the port will be an end point.
